DIY Environment How thick should a layer of grass clippings be for winter mulching? December 19, 2025 by Herb | Leave a Comment Grass clippings can be an excellent choice for winter mulching, offering numerous benefits such as moisture retention and nutrient addition to the soil. For optimal results, a layer of grass clippings should be about 2-3 inches thick. This thickness provides effective insulation and protection for your garden beds during the cold months.
